About Loudoun County Board of Elections

The Loudoun County Board of Elections, located in Leesburg, VA, is a government office that oversees local elections in Leesburg. The Board of Elections holds general elections, caucuses, primaries, and special elections, including elections for Leesburg, Loudoun County, Virginia state, and federal offices. The Leesburg Elections Department, also known as the Board of Registrars, manages poll locations, certifies election results, and promotes fair and legal elections.
